利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:[‘adam’, ‘LISA’, ‘barT’],输出:[‘Adam’, ‘Lisa’, ‘Bart’]:

name = ['adam', 'LISA', 'barT']def normalize(name):result = name[0].upper() + name[1:].lower()return resultprint(list(map(normalize, name)))

python利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字相关推荐

  1. 廖雪峰python.pdf-74 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。

    练习 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A','barT'],输出:['Adam', 'Lisa', 'Bart'] ...

  2. 【Python】利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    微信公众号 题目来源:[廖雪峰的官方网站-map/reduce] 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'bar ...

  3. 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字以及Map函数讲解

    利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字. 输入:['adam', 'LISA', 'barT']. 输出:['Adam', 'Lisa', 'Bart'] ...

  4. 利用map()函数,把用户输入的不规则的英文名字,变为首字母大写,其他小写。

    1.map()函数接收两个参数,一个是函数,另一个是Iterable,map将传入的函数依次作用到序列的每一个元素,并把结果作为新的Iterable返回. 2.map()传入的第一个参数是r,即函数对 ...

  5. 利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']:

    利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']: ...

  6. 廖雪峰——练习 请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字。输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']。

    请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字.输入:['adam', 'LISA', 'barT'],输出:['Adam', 'Lisa', 'Bart']. 之前在网上找这个题 ...

  7. JavaScript-请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    请把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字 function normalize(arr) {function correct(word){var list ='';for(i ...

  8. 【廖雪峰 python教程 课后题改编】利用map()函数,把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字

    原题目: # -*- coding: utf-8 -*- #输入名字,变成首字母大写,其他字母小写的标准格式 def normalize(name):str1 = ''for i, ch in enu ...

  9. 廖雪峰 练习 把用户输入的不规范的英文名字,变为首字母大写,其他小写的规范名字...

    # -*- coding: utf-8 -*- #输入名字,变成首字母大写,其他字母小写的标准格式 def normalize(name):str1 = ''for i, ch in enumerat ...

最新文章

  1. SAP 差旅报销集成方案的实现
  2. PYTHON-模块timedatetime+ 目录规范
  3. 比特币现金将出新招,推动比特币现金使用
  4. 《JavaScript应用程序设计》一一3.2 流式JavaScript
  5. UVa719 Glass Bread(后缀数组解法)
  6. 【codeforces】【比赛题解】#940 CF Round #466 (Div. 2)
  7. 根据Word表格自动生成SQL数据库脚本的VBScript代码
  8. 2018危机与机遇丨PMCAFF年度精选合集
  9. Matlab | 数字信号处理:用窗函数法设计FIR数字滤波器
  10. post multipart/form-data 类型表单如何获取File外其他参数
  11. 【EasyNetQ】- 发送接收
  12. esp32找不到com端口_玩转GPIO之ESP32点灯大法(MicroPython版)
  13. docker安装mysql8_Centos7-Docker-安装Mysql8
  14. Visual Studio调试时失去响应的解决办法
  15. Redis数据类型及使用场景
  16. mysql外码内码定义_Windows | 简体中文编码——输入码(外码)、区位码、国标码(交换码)、机内码(内码)、输出码(字形码)区别及联系...
  17. Javascript注释规范
  18. CRC校验工具----CRC8校验 (x8+x2+x+1)
  19. 软件开发中如何评估工作量
  20. 云锁linux宝塔安装,宝塔面板安装云锁

热门文章

  1. 纯js逆向淘宝阿里云滑块破解
  2. 新浪微博开发之查看详细微博的实现
  3. ModuleNotFoundError: No moudle named torchtext
  4. Swift Selector
  5. xser-php-framework-0_11 正式版
  6. Java编程——输出1000以内的素数(质数)
  7. Fragment实现类似activity onResume()功能,控制fragment可见与不可见
  8. [杀毒防毒]用Mcafee打造自己的安全系统详解
  9. BUUCTF Misc 认真你就输了
  10. echarts 3D地球实现自动旋转